当前位置: 首页 > 新闻资讯  > 统一身份认证

基于统一身份认证系统的排行榜解决方案

本文探讨了如何通过构建统一身份认证系统实现排行榜功能,并提出了一种兼顾数据安全与用户体验的解决方案。

在信息化时代,统一身份认证系统(Unified Identity Authentication System)已成为保障网络服务安全性和便捷性的关键基础设施。该系统通过整合多个独立的身份验证机制,提供一致且可靠的用户身份管理服务。与此同时,排行榜作为展示用户成就或排名的重要工具,在社交平台、在线教育、游戏等领域得到了广泛应用。然而,随着用户数量的增长和技术复杂性的提升,如何在确保数据安全的同时实现高效的排行榜计算,成为亟待解决的技术难题。

统一身份认证

 

为应对上述挑战,我们提出了一套综合解决方案。首先,统一身份认证系统应具备强大的权限控制能力,确保只有授权用户能够访问排行榜数据。这可以通过引入基于角色的访问控制(RBAC)模型实现,将用户划分为不同的角色,例如普通用户、管理员等,并赋予其相应的操作权限。此外,还需对敏感信息进行加密处理,防止未经授权的数据泄露。

 

其次,为了提高排行榜的实时性与准确性,可以采用分布式架构设计。利用云计算资源,将排行榜的计算任务分散到多个服务器上执行,从而降低单点故障风险并提升响应速度。同时,引入缓存技术(如Redis),将频繁访问的数据存储在内存中,进一步优化性能。

 

再者,针对排行榜可能出现的异常情况,如恶意刷榜行为,需部署智能监控系统。通过分析用户的操作模式和历史记录,识别潜在的欺诈行为,并及时采取措施予以制止。例如,设置每日提交次数上限,或者引入机器学习算法预测异常活动。

 

最后,为了增强用户体验,排行榜界面的设计也至关重要。应提供多样化的排序选项(按时间、分数等),并支持多语言切换等功能,满足全球化需求。此外,还需定期收集用户反馈,不断改进系统功能,确保其始终符合业务需求。

 

综上所述,通过构建完善的统一身份认证系统以及合理的排行榜解决方案,不仅能够有效保护用户隐私和数据安全,还能显著提升系统的稳定性和可用性。这一组合方案为各类互联网应用提供了可靠的技术支撑,有助于推动行业的持续发展。

本站部分内容及素材来源于互联网,如有侵权,联系必删!

相关资讯

    暂无相关的数据...